Buyer checklist

  • Check engine and PTO hours; service history matters for long-term reliability.
  • Confirm PTO speed (540/1000) and HP match your mowers, balers, or other implements.
  • Inspect hydraulics and three-point hitch condition; repair costs can be high.

For used John Deere 2030, hours and service history matter. Confirm PTO and hydraulic operation, tire condition, and that implements match your HP and category.

  • Does the John Deere 2030 have a PTO?

    Yes. The John Deere 2030 has a rear PTO rated at 60 HP at 540 rpm.

  • What is the horsepower of the John Deere 2030?

    The John Deere 2030 is rated at 71 HP (gross) (53 kW).
